What the record actually contains

Max Stoiber's visible path ingredients

Austrian JavaScript engineer who shipped popular React OSS (including react-boilerplate) and co-created styled-components in 2016 while working in open source (Thinkmill). Shortly after co-founded Spectrum (acquired by GitHub), later founded Stellate (acquired by Shopify), then engineering leadership at Shopify and OpenAI.

What no quiz can recover

Luck acts across the entire path

Luck is not a fifth score. It changes the transitions between starting position, capability, trajectory, and outcome—and this successful-only dataset cannot estimate its size.

Structural luck

Birthplace, era, family, geography, institutions, and being near the right frontier.

Encounter luck

Meeting a collaborator, mentor, coach, investor, selector, or first customer.

Event luck

An algorithm boost, market shock, competitor failure, injury avoided, or unexpected opening.

Outcome variance

Similar visible inputs can still produce different results for reasons the record cannot recover.

Sequence matters

A score cannot reproduce this ordering

  1. 2016 · age 22Co-created styled-components with Glen Maddern

    Popularizing CSS-in-JS for React.

  2. 2017 · age 23Co-founded Spectrum as CTO

    Company later acquired by GitHub.

  3. 2018 · age 24Joined GitHub as a software engineer

    Spectrum acquisition.
